Introduction :

  • Paul David Tripp is an American pastor, author, and motivational speaker.
  • His mission in his work is to have people realize that the grace of Jesus Christ comes with hope, by connecting Christ’s power to everyday life.

Personal Life, Parents and Family Details :

  • Paul David Tripp was born on November 12, 1950, in Toledo, Ohio, to parents Bob Tripp (father) and Fae Tripp (mother).
  • Tripp went off to college in 1968, majoring in Bible and Christian Education.
  • In 1971, while still attending college, Tripp met and married his wife, Luella Jackson; they have four children. During that same year, he took on his first job as a pastor.
  • A few years later, Tripp started a church and Christian School in Scranton, Ohio.
  • In 1987, after living in Ohio with his family for many years, Paul decided to move with his family to Philadelphia, where the family continues to reside today.
  • In 2014, Tripp became ill with kidney failure. What followed were many surgeries and several hospital stays. In excruciating pain, his illness left him physically, emotionally, and spiritually drained.
  • Eventually, as Tripp recovered, he realized that his life experiences and faith had helped him deal with his illness and pain.
  • With much candor, Tripp has used his own circumstances to reach people that are also suffering.

Early Life and Education :

  • In 1968, Tripp began attending Columbia Bible College (now Columbia International University). There he studied Bible and Christian Education and graduated in 1972.
  • Upon completing his undergraduate studies, Tripp began working on a Master of Divinity at Philadelphia Theological Seminary. He completed his studies there in 1975.

Career, Income, Salary and Net Worth :

  • In 1971, Tripp became a pastor for the first time in his career.
  • He started at a local church and Christian school in Scranton. Unfortunately, due to local issues and Tripp’s lack of experience as a minister, he was met with a lot of scrutiny.
  • He has said when looking back that those were some of the most difficult days in his career.
  • Despite the obstacles, Tripp continued with his work and his life-long mission in ministry.
  • In 2006, he became the president of Paul Tripp Ministries, a position he holds to this day.
  • In 2007, while continuing his duties as president, Tripp also became part of the pastoral staff at Tenth Presbyterian Church, a local church located in Philadelphia.
  • Tripp added academia to his resume by working as a professor at Redeemer Seminary in 2009.
  • In addition to all his other work, Tripp also serves as the Executive Director of the Center for Pastoral Life and Care.
  • Tripp has traveled all over the world and has ministered to thousands.
